The key components in this recipe are simple yet impactful. You will use 1.5 pounds of chicken breast, cubed to a bite-sized perfection, ensuring everyone enjoys each piece. The magic truly lies in the glaze, made with a quarter cup of bourbon, a third cup of brown sugar, blended with soy sauce, apple cider vinegar, garlic, and ginger. This mix creates a rich flavor profile, combining sweetness and umami, perfectly complementing the tender chicken.

Despite the amazing flavor, preparing this dish is straightforward. Start by tossing the chicken in beaten egg and cornstarch for that signature crunch. Once your air fryer is preheated to 400°F (200°C), the chicken cooks in just 12-14 minutes, turning golden and crispy. As the chicken cooks, you’ll prepare the glaze on the stovetop, allowing the bourbon’s robust flavor to mellow as the alcohol cooks off. Finally, after tossing the crispy chicken in the glaze, you simply garnish with sesame seeds and green onions before serving.

Chicken Tips

When selecting chicken for this recipe, opt for fresh, high-quality chicken breasts. Look for breasts that are plump and have a light pink color with no discoloration. If possible, choose organic or free-range chicken for better flavor and texture. For even more tender bites, you might consider marinating the chicken in a bit of soy sauce or even some bourbon for an hour before cooking. This will infuse the chicken with flavor and keep it juicy during the cooking process.

Options for Substitutions

  • Chicken: Swap chicken breast for chicken thighs or tenders for a richer flavor.
  • Cornstarch: Use rice flour or tapioca starch if you want a gluten-free alternative.
  • Bourbon: Substitute bourbon with apple cider or grape juice to make a non-alcoholic version.
  • Brown Sugar: Coconut sugar or honey can work as natural sweeteners if preferred.
  • Soy Sauce: Tamari sauce or liquid aminos are excellent gluten-free alternatives.
  • Apple Cider Vinegar: White vinegar or lemon juice can be used if apple cider vinegar is unavailable.

Watch Out for These Mistakes

One common mistake is not adequately preheating the air fryer. This step is essential as it ensures the chicken cooks evenly and achieves that perfect crispy texture. If the air fryer is not hot enough, the chicken may end up soggy rather than crispy.

Another pitfall is overcrowding the air fryer basket. Cooking the chicken in a single layer allows for proper air circulation, promoting even cooking. If the pieces overlap, you’ll find that they do not cook uniformly and might stick together.

Finally, ensure you’re careful with seasoning amounts, particularly with the soy sauce and salt elements. It can be easy to overdo it, resulting in an overly salty dish. Always measure your ingredients and taste the glaze before tossing the chicken in for potential adjustments.

Storage Instructions

Store: In the fridge, these chicken bites will last up to 4 days. Make sure to keep them in an airtight container to preserve their texture and flavor.

Freeze: If you want to make a larger batch, you can freeze the chicken bites. They will be safe for up to 2-3 months when placed in a freezer-safe bag or container.

Reheat: For the best results, reheat these bites in the air fryer at 375°F (190°C) for about 5-7 minutes, which will help restore some of the crispiness. Alternatively, you can use a microwave on a low setting, but this may cause the chicken to lose some of its crunch.

Ingredients

  • 1.5 lb chicken breast (cubed)
  • 1/2 cup cornstarch
  • 1 egg (beaten)
  • 1/4 cup bourbon
  • 1/3 cup brown sugar
  • 3 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p apple cider vinegar
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 tsp ginger (grated)
  • sesame seeds
  • green onions
  • cooking spray

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by cubing the chicken breast into bite-sized pieces. In a bowl, toss the chicken cubes with the beaten egg until they are well coated. Then, add the cornstarch to the bowl and mix until each piece of chicken is evenly covered.

Step 2: Preheat the Air Fryer

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C). Once ready, spray the air fryer basket generously with cooking spray to prevent sticking.

Step 3: Arrange the Chicken

Carefully place the cornstarch-coated chicken pieces in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Make sure not to overcrowd the basket; this helps the chicken cook evenly.

Step 4: Air Fry the Chicken

Air fry the chicken for 12-14 minutes. Stop halfway through to shake the basket, ensuring the chicken cooks evenly and gets that wonderful crispy coating.

Step 5: Make the Bourbon Glaze

While the chicken is cooking, grab a saucepan. Combine the bourbon, brown sugar, soy sauce, apple cider vinegar, minced garlic, and grated ginger. Simmer on medium heat for about 5 minutes until slightly thickened. The alcohol will mellow, leaving just the rich flavor.

Step 6: Toss Chicken in the Glaze

Once the chicken is golden and crispy, transfer it to a large bowl. Pour the bourbon glaze over the chicken and gently toss until each piece is well coated.

Step 7: Garnish and Serve

Transfer your glazed chicken to a serving dish. Garnish with sesame seeds and chopped green onions. Serve over rice to soak up all that delicious sauce.
